Cadillac Unveils First Formula 1 Car Livery During Super Bowl: A Bold Move Ahead of 2026 Season

In a thrilling announcement made during the Super Bowl, Cadillac has officially unveiled the first livery of their upcoming Formula 1 car, set to debut in the 2026 season. This strategic move comes amid a growing interest in the sport within the United States, as the luxury automotive brand waves its banner alongside major teams. The timing couldn’t be more critical, as F1 aims to expand its footprint in North America and entice new fans.

Official Details

The unveiling was confirmed by the FIA (Fédération Internationale de l’Automobile) and Cadillac, marking a landmark moment for the automaker entering the highly competitive F1 arena. This initiative aligns with the sport’s new power unit regulations set to take effect in 2026, focusing on sustainability and hybrid technology. Cadillac’s debut livery signifies not just a fresh design but also the brand’s commitment to cutting-edge racing technology and innovation.

Context

Cadillac’s launch comes on the heels of F1’s rapid expansion in North America, especially with the introduction of new races and renewed interest from American car manufacturers. The 2023 season has already seen a surge in viewership in the U.S. thanks to initiatives like Netflix’s "Drive to Survive" series, which has captivated audiences and further popularized the sport. Cadillac’s desire to tap into this burgeoning market is evident, marking a new chapter not just for the brand but also for the wider implications for motorsport in the region.
